Termination of Proceeding Not Determinative. The termination of a Proceeding by judgment, order, settlement, or conviction, or upon a plea of nolo contendere or its equivalent shall not, of itself, create a presumption or be determinative that Indemnitee is not entitled to indemnification or reimbursement of Expenses hereunder or otherwise.
